MEDALS-RIBBONS: Purple Heart w/2 Stars, Bronze Star, Rifle Expert, Pistol Expert, Marine Corps Good Conduct w/1 Star, American Defense w/1 Star, Prisoner of War, Presidential Unit Citation, Philippine Liberation, Asiatic-Pacific Campaign, World War I Victory
A "Marine's Marine" Don was captured in the defense of the Philippines. He survived the "Death March" although wounded. Awarded two Purple Hearts and the Bronze Star.
